REalloys Inc. (ALOY) has entered into a 15-year Rare Earth Product Offtake Agreement with Critical Metals Corp, securing a supply of rare earth element concentrate from the Tanbreez mining project in Greenland. The agreement, effective May 15, 2026, covers the initial production phase of the project and includes key elements such as neodymium-praseodymium (NdPr), dysprosium (Dy), and terbium (Tb).

Key Details

  • Agreement Terms: REalloys is committed to purchase 15% of the monthly Phase 1 production from the Tanbreez project for an initial term of 15 years, commencing on a future "Supply Start Date."
  • Volume & Capacity: The commitment is tied to the project's Phase 1, which has a nameplate capacity of up to 15,000 metric tons per year, obligating REalloys to purchase a maximum of 2,250 metric tons annually.
  • Pricing Structure: The price for the concentrate will be calculated based on a formula involving payable percentages for each element (e.g., 75% for NdPr), contractual recovery yields (>85%), and the higher of a six-month trailing average of ex-China industry indices or a floor price with a 2% annual escalation.
